Key Steps for Successful E-commerce App Development


Building a profitable eCommerce app involves thoughtful planning, strategy, and implementation. Here are the ten crucial steps you need to follow to guarantee your app is both user-friendly and revenue-generating:

Define Your Business Objectives
Explicitly outline your business goals and the problems you aim to address. Understanding your target audience and business model is essential for creating features that align with your vision. Whether you're selling products, services, or subscriptions, establishing these early on will determine your app’s design and features.

Conduct Market Research
Study your competitors, ongoing market trends, and customer preferences. This step enables identify opportunities in the market and define a USP for your app. A thorough market study allows you to develop an app that stands out and meets unmet customer demands, increasing your likelihood of success.

Choose the Best Development Platform
Decide whether you’ll build a platform-specific app for iOS and Android or go for a multi-platform solution. Native apps provide better speed but are more costly, while multi-platform solutions allow you to reach multiple audiences at a lower cost. Choose based on your financial resources, target audience, and growth potential requirements.

Focus on UX/UI Design
Create an intuitive, user-friendly interface that retains customers engaged. A well-designed eCommerce app should simplify the process for users to browse, find, and buy products. Prioritize mobile-first concepts and make sure the checkout process is seamless and efficient, reducing cart drop-off rates.

Build Essential Features
Incorporate core eCommerce features such as item listings, secure payment gateways, shopping carts, Strategies for increasing sales in ecommerce apps and user login systems. Concentrate on creating an MVP (Minimum Viable Product) with key features to get started fast. You can later add more features as you receive user input and grow.

Build a Robust Backend
Ensure your backend is strong enough to support the app’s functions, including handling databases, servers, and API connections. A strong backend infrastructure is crucial for handling user data, processing transactions, and guaranteeing overall app speed. Focus on security and scalability early on.

Integrate Secure Payment Gateways
Add reliable payment gateways to provide a seamless and secure transaction experience for users. Include options like credit cards, PayPal, and e-wallets, and ensure the system supports multiple currencies if you're reaching a international audience. Security should always be a main focus to establish customer trust.

Incorporate Enhanced Security Features
Safeguard your app and user data by using security measures such as SSL encryption, two-factor authentication, and safe APIs. Frequent security reviews and updates are essential to safeguard your app from potential breaches and make sure of compliance with sector regulations, like PCI-DSS for payment security.

Test Your App Rigorously
Before releasing, perform thorough testing to spot and fix any bugs or performance problems. This involves functional, usability, and load testing across various devices and platforms. Live user testing can provide valuable feedback to ensure the app meets your customers' demands and performs well.

Release and Optimize
Once your app passes all tests, it’s time to launch! Use app store optimization techniques to increase visibility and execute marketing strategies to increase downloads. After launch, continue monitoring performance and user feedback to release updates and enhance features, making sure your app stays competitive and user-friendly.
